Saturday, November 21, 2009

Salt Lake City, Utah

Miles driven today: 518
Hours on the road: 8 (ish)
Hotel: Homewood Suites

We could not believe the weather when we stepped out of the hotel this morning - it was so cold and windy! It was quite impressive to look out on the freeway and see the tumbleweed racing along almost as fast as the cars.
Once on the freeway we realized how windy it really was. It took a lot of concentration to keep the car going in straight line - add to that the tumbleweed coming towards us from all directions. Phil observed that it was a bit like being in space and hitting an asteroid belt. I got a few "asteroids" stuck in my front grill....

We arrived in Salt Lake City around 8pm. The temperature was reading 59 degrees, but it felt more like minus 59! It was so cold.....brrrrr!
Getting stuck in the elevator was the major excitement of the evening.....not for long....probably less than a minute before it restarted again. It seemed a lot longer and it was interesting to see how quickly people began to look worried....!!

Friday, November 20, 2009

Pacifica

Our journey begins at Rockaway Beach, Pacifica, CA.

We arrived in the afternoon just in time to unpack and take a walk down to see the beautiful West Coast sunset.


The Holiday Inn Express is fantastically located right on the beach front.

That evening we ate dinner at Nick's which is a very short walk from the hotel. The place doesn't really look anything from the outside, or even the inside for that matter. It actually reminded me of a 1970's working men's club with it's bar at the edge of the retro dance floor and shabby looking carpets all around. I am so happy that I got over my first impression and sat down to eat. The food was just AMAZING! I had one of the specials which was snapper with crab meat............yum!!
